Safety measures

 
 

Holidays 2008: the guide for lone parents

  • Get advice about the country you are travelling to by contacting the Foreign and Commonwealth Office on 0845 850 2829 or see www.fco.gov.uk.
  • Carry a recent photo of your child in case you become separated. You can also give your child a recent picture of you to carry with them.
  • On the back of a card (or make a  band  for their wrist), write your your mobile number (if you have one and it can be used in area you are holidaying in) or telephone number for where you are staying and contact information for a close friend or relative. Give this to your child to carry with them during the holiday. Talk to your child about what to do if they are lost (who they should talk to, for example, somebody who works at the resort, a security guard or police officer) and make sure they understand that it is an absolute rule that they do not go anywhere without telling you or the person who is looking after them.
  • Make a list of important phone numbers, such as your country's embassy details if travelling abroad, your travel insurer, the number for cancelling any bank cards, the numbers of family or friends who might be able to help in case of an emergency. Take a copy with you and keep another at the place you are staying.
  • Make a copy of your travel insurance policy, including the emergency telephone number, and leave a copy with a friend or family member so they can access it if they need to for any reason. You might want to do the same for your passport and take a copy with you.
